
Authware图片动态显示技术实现

根据提供的文件信息,我们可以推测出文件内容与Authware软件的使用有关,特别是在Authware中实现动态显示图片的功能。Authware是一款多媒体创作工具,它提供了一个流程图导向的开发环境,允许用户创建丰富的互动应用程序。以下将对标题和描述中提及的知识点进行详细的说明。
### Authware动态显示图片
#### 知识点一:Authware简介
Authware是一款由Macromedia公司开发的多媒体创作工具。Authware的主要特点是可以制作出具有交互性的课件、游戏、演示文稿等。它采用流程图导向的开发方式,通过拖放式的接口,即使是编程经验不多的用户也可以快速上手并创建复杂的互动应用。
#### 知识点二:动态显示图片的原理
在Authware中实现动态显示图片,主要依赖于以下几个要素:
1. **媒体对象的导入**:首先需要将图片文件导入Authware的媒体库中。
2. **显示图标(Display Icon)的使用**:Authware中的显示图标可以用来在屏幕上呈现图片、文本等多媒体内容。
3. **控制结构**:Authware提供多种控制结构,例如循环、条件判断等,这些控制结构可以用来编写动态显示图片的逻辑。
4. **动画和过渡效果**:Authware支持为显示的图片添加动画和过渡效果,使图片的展示更加生动和流畅。
#### 知识点三:源代码的作用
虽然Authware是一款不需要传统编程语言的工具,但是在高级应用中,Authware同样支持使用Lingo编程语言来增强应用的功能性。源代码"show-pic.a7p"很可能包含了用于动态展示图片的脚本代码,这些代码通过Lingo语言编写,可以在Authware的流程图中添加自定义逻辑。
#### 知识点四:Authware中的Lingo编程语言
Lingo是一种专门为Authware设计的脚本语言,它用于增强Authware的交互性和动态效果。通过编写Lingo代码,用户可以控制媒体的播放、响应用户的交互、执行复杂的计算等。了解Lingo语言是深入使用Authware必不可少的一步。
#### 知识点五:动态显示图片的实现方法
在Authware中动态显示图片,可以通过以下步骤实现:
1. **导入图片资源**:将需要动态展示的图片导入Authware。
2. **创建显示图标**:拖动显示图标到流程线上,并将相应的图片拖拽到显示图标内。
3. **编写Lingo脚本**:在显示图标后的脚本区域编写Lingo代码,以实现对图片的动态展示。
- 例如,可以通过Lingo控制图片的显示位置、显示顺序等。
4. **使用控制结构**:利用Authware的控制结构,如等待、循环等,实现图片的动态切换效果。
5. **测试与调试**:运行流程图并观察效果,根据需要调整Lingo脚本和控制结构,优化动态展示效果。
#### 知识点六:Authware的文件管理
Authware的文件结构通常包括以下几个部分:
- **主文件(.a7p)**:这是包含整个项目所有元素的主文件,它管理流程图、图标以及各种媒体资源。
- **资源文件(.a7r)**:包含项目中的所有媒体资源,如图片、声音、视频等。
压缩包中的"show-pic.a7p"文件,可能是包含所有相关工作流程、脚本和媒体资源的主文件。这样的文件结构方便进行项目管理、分享和部署。
综上所述,Authware动态显示图片的实现涉及到多媒体资源的导入、显示图标的设置、Lingo编程语言的应用以及流程控制结构的综合运用。掌握这些知识点能够帮助用户有效地在Authware平台制作出吸引人的动态图片展示效果。
相关推荐



ufo231
- 粉丝: 1
最新资源
- 8bit Raw到RGB24 Bmp图像转换演示源码
- C++数据结构优质课件资源分享
- VC实现WAV文件波形实时显示技术与源码解析
- 新世纪版五笔编码表支持QQ五笔与极点五笔
- 仿Apple滑动展示效果的图片滚动技术
- Shareaza源码分析:C++构建的全能P2P下载工具
- WPF程序设计指南:深入浅出的补充教程
- WinForm动画加载控件使用示例
- 探索JavaScript中图片批量处理技术
- 经典商业后台管理模板设计与应用
- 掌握mysql-connector-java-5.1.12驱动,连接MySQL与Eclipse开发环境
- SLIC DUMP ToolKit V2.3 Final更新发布:增强功能与搜索性能
- 掌握CKEditor在线编辑器及其配置技巧
- 简单对话框托盘程序VC源码解析
- 宝宝取名神器:朗读版软件功能解析
- LCD12864显示屏原理与应用解析
- 中文版DHTML手册CHM格式使用指南
- C++实现Gauss消去法及相关算法详解
- IBM黑鼠标指针,ThinkPad风格的个性化定制
- 深入理解Java JMX技术:MBean在资源管理中的应用
- 学生成绩管理系统的完整解决方案与案例分析
- 实用绿色屏幕截图工具:免安装,多模式捕获
- 中文版AVI转GIF动画工具:一键操作轻松搞定
- C8051F50x-51x系列单片机CAN收发程序开发